Under the cover of the night, the trio-Luke, Brian, and John-made their way through the dimly lit streets of West Baltimore.

Luke, Brian, and John opted for attire that blended into the urban night. Luke chose a dark hoodie, concealing much of his features. Brian, with an understanding of the city's underground, wore a leather jacket. John, less experienced in the art of shadiness, settled for a casual look-a hoodie and jeans.

As they reached the door, Brian, experienced in this area, took the lead. He knocked on the door with a distinct pattern, a signal recognized by those on the other side.

The door cracked open, revealing a burly bouncer who eyed them with a scrutinizing gaze.

"Good evening Tony, looking sharp."

The bouncer didn't speak back to him, he only stepped aside, granting them entry.

The trio entered a dimly lit corridor, muffled sounds of distant fights and raucous cheers emanated from beyond the walls.

"When we open this next door- you all shut your mouths and do not speak unless spoken to." Brian made clear.

"Yes sir, Master Wright." Luke says jokingly.

Brian, unamused, glanced at Luke.

"Please do not get yourself killed. This is the hangout area of some of the most dangerous criminals in the city."

With a push, Brian opened the door, revealing the heart of Shen-Tek's underground empire. The trio stepped into a heavily lit arena.

Tons of adoring fans are yelling for their favorite fighters, some fans even have V.I.P seats!

"AND OUR WINNER IS SHAMROCK!"

A loud voice echoed from the top stands! He was standing in front of a throne. He had a skull mask made from real bone covering his face, and a crown incrusted with jewels on his head. Shen-Tek wasn't wearing a shirt, showing off his skin covered in tribal tattoos, intricate patterns painted on his body.

"Anyone here think they can go toe to toe with our champion here? No? I didn't think so!" Shen-Tek's laughter echoed through the room as the crowd roared.

Brian, seizing the moment, smiled and stood up from the stands. "Shamrock here isn't anything compared to my friend Spine-Eater!" he declared, raising Luke's arm in the air.

"Brian! Are you fucking nuts?!" Luke protested, pulling his arm down, but it was too late.

"Spine-Eater, you say?" Shen-Tek's interest peaked.

"If that means we've got a challenger... LET'S SEE WHAT SPINE-EATER IS MADE OF!"

Brian walks with Luke to the ring...

"Come on Spine-Eater, we've got to go beat that Irish bastard!"

Brian said.

"This isn't real- this isn't real. Brian, he is twice my body mass! Look at him! He could snap me in half, the only thing I've got on him his height." Luke was panicking.

"Trust me, you are going to be a menace." Brian said unfazed by Luke's worried nature.

Luke stepped into the ring, Brian and John being on the outside being his supporters.
